HS55 Wireless Random Mic Sensitivity Max


Recommended Posts

Hello. I bought an HS55 Wireless a few months back and after about a month I was told that my mic can randomly sound garbled and static-y. I checked my Mic settings and iCue settings - all drivers are up to date. I checked the volume levels and every time I would even slightly breathe into the mic the sensitivity or output level would max, instantaneously. If I disable the device in Sound settings and then re-enable it, the problem goes away (for a period of time) so it's not hardware, it's software.

I really like the headset as a whole, but for this to be happening so early I've just been going nuts. Anyone have any advice or insight?

iCue version: 5.5.134

HS55 Wireless version: 0.11.102

HS55 Wireless Receiver firmware version: 0.8.52

I am having this problem as well.  Brand new HS55 wireless headphones.  Connected via the RF dongle.  Installed the iQUE software and updated firmware, then found the software didn't provide ANY features other than firmware updating, so I removed it.  I have tried changing the audio bit rate, and also tried turning off/on audio enhancements.  Rebooting did not help.  Like others, I found changing the selected microphone then changing it back resolves the trouble temporarily.
